Output a4e62a94de6168039e170b7c751c423a72d172fda4b55f349c51af82da429863:65

value
51000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 41ab055a162f21b74b8f2fdebfe3f6cddaad0088d70494fde7e122960e19a0c4
address
tb1pgx4s2ksk9usmwju09l0tlclkehd26qyg6uzffl08uy3fvrse5rzq0x66yj
transaction
a4e62a94de6168039e170b7c751c423a72d172fda4b55f349c51af82da429863
confirmations
18558
spent
true